X-ray imaging is essential for orthopedic procedures, aiding in diagnosis, intraoperative guidance, and surgical planning.
-
2
2D/3D registration reconstructs patient-specific 3D models from 2D radiographs, improving surgical planning while minimizing radiation exposure.
-
3
The proposed deep learning network estimates a registration field from calibrated radiographs, avoiding the need for additional segmentation.
-
4
The registration method decomposes the transformation into affine and local components, enhancing flexibility in input data orientation.
-
5
Validation of the network was performed using simulated digitally reconstructed radiographs, demonstrating its effectiveness compared to existing methods.
